Simulating Engine Control: A Volvo EC290 ECU Trainer
Volvo's EC290 excavator is a powerful and versatile machine. To ensure operators can hone their skills and technicians can diagnose and repair issues effectively, specialized training tools are essential. One such tool is the Volvo EC290 ECU trainer, designed to mimic the complex engine control unit (ECU) of the excavator. This sophisticated simulator allows users to adjust various engine parameters in a safe and controlled environment. Through hands-on experience, trainees can learn about how the ECU functions and the impact of different settings on the excavator's performance.
The EC290 ECU trainer incorporates a user-friendly interface that displays key engine data, such as RPM, temperature, and fuel consumption. Users can modify parameters like injection timing, boost pressure, and idle speed, observing the real-time effects on the simulated engine. This allows for a comprehensive understanding of the interplay between different components and how they contribute to overall performance.
- Moreover, the trainer can be used to diagnose common ECU faults by simulating various sensor failures and providing troubleshooting guidance.
- This hands-on approach enhances learning and retention, preparing operators and technicians for real-world scenarios.
